Mission & Goals
The Association of the European Producers of Laminate Flooring (EPLF), established in 1994, is an association incorporated under German law (Registration No. VR 3897, AG Bielefeld), representing the leading producers of laminate flooring in Europe and their suppliers. Its mission is to raise awareness about the benefits of laminate flooring and represent the interests of the European Producers of Laminate Flooring. To do so, EPLF will: -EDUCATE by providing information on the product and the industry -PROMOTE the reputation of laminate flooring and the industry -LEVERAGE the wealth of expertise of the network -FOSTER the highest quality for laminate flooring through standardisation Its vision is to enable a sustainable laminate flooring industry.
EU Legislative Interests
-Circular Economy Action Plan (CEAP) -Ecodesign for Sustainable Products Regulation (ESPR) -Construction Products Regulation (CPR) -Waste Framework Directive -Packaging (PPWR) -Labelling/Marking Requirements -Consumer and Sales Guarantees Directive -EU Deforestation Regulation (EUDR) -European Affordable Housing Plan -EU Bioeconomy Strategy -Public Procurement Directive
Communication Activities
Meeting with MEP in June 2025 and meeting with DG ENV in March 2025 to discuss the EU Deforestation Regulation (EUDR) and the EU's Housing Strategy.

Additional Information
The total for policy-related work and activities covered under the EU Transparency Register amounted to EUR 59,387.5 in 2025, billed per hour by consultants (SEC Newgate EU S.A.). This amount was also included by SEC Newgate EU during their annual review in the EU Transparency Register.
